Output 12df3ed24ab13d2c4b52287f7abe6d8ee6fd0a9a595fdccdee7d1a413f73d6c9:1

value
43428260
script pubkey
OP_0 OP_PUSHBYTES_20 b8efffc5683a48f431750a8d62ddba3c6827557f
address
bc1qhrhll3tg8fy0gvt4p2xk9hd6835zw4tlztrvx6
transaction
12df3ed24ab13d2c4b52287f7abe6d8ee6fd0a9a595fdccdee7d1a413f73d6c9
confirmations
2012
spent
true